Overview:
The Road Pony was a transitional design that uses an older style (tech level C) chassis often produced by a purchaser's local industrial base like previous designs, but it used a more advanced engine, electronics, and armor. It is one of the first third generation (tech level D) designs that RDS, or any contractor for that matter, introduced, and RDS most often provided the more technologically complex components or, less often, assisted purchasers in upgrading their manufacturing capabilities to produce the complex components in-house. The first Road Pony was delivered on 2387. As an Infantry Fighting Vehicle the Road Pony excelled against the 2nd generation infantry fighting vehicles it first encountered on battlefields across the Inner Sphere, but within 30 years of its introduction it was superseded by a multitude of designs including RDS' Swamp Pony that was derived from the Road Pony. RDS repeatedly attempted to retire the Road Pony but was unsuccessful because users insisted on continued support for the design these efforts were unsuccessful. By 2413 RDS was successful in providing only some advanced component parts for the design and by 2424 RDS had completely abandoned the design. Despite this, there were at least 15 manufacturers still supplied advanced components for the design through the 26th century. The Road Pony can be seen today in many local mechanized forces, but these models almost always mount an SRM-4 or LRM-5s.

Capabilities:
The Road Pony is a design that has been surprisingly resilient. The Road Pony's light logistical footprint and high mobility kept it in service long after it should have been retired, it it is also the reason tens of thousands serve in planetary militias today.
This mobility proves to be very important as a commander seeks to overcome the deficiencies in the Road Pony's weapons and armor. The ineffectiveness of the Light Rifle against heavy armor and its short range prompts the Road Pony's commander to use it primarily to assault unarmored fortifications, infantry, and other lightly armored vehicles. In this role, it is highly effective, and it has the speed and off-road capabilities to deliver an infantry squad to the front-line and extract that same infantry squad in the event that a retreat becomes necessary.

Deployment:
Surprisingly, despite its general ineffectiveness in its assigned role, the Road Pony was highly popular. By the time RDS had completely abandoned the design, RDS had records for more than 120,000 Road Ponys.
The Road Pony continued to be produced into the 2600s, but production had dramatically tapered off and was often only a one-for-one replacement for Road Ponies that were destroyed or unservicable.
The Road Pony continued to be produced through-out the Succession Wars and even re-emerged during the Word of Blake Jihad, but these production runs have been local to individual planets

Variants:
In 2491, the militia forces on XXXX, a heavy user of the Road Pony, attempted to extend the life of the design. Converting more than 500 of the design to a model that replaced the light rifle with an SRM-4 with a full ton of ammunition and a machinegun with half a ton of ammunition, the XXXXX discovered that the Road Pony's effectiveness was increased exponentially. This design was extremely popular and by 2515 more than 40,000 Road Ponies had been converted to this model. Unfortunately, this model's endurance on the battlefield was increased as well, and it was being used in roles it had not originally be intended for. During periods of conflict, commanders would use the Road Pony to directly engage heavier combat vehicles rather than support infantry. In 2505 a new, paired variant emerged with the intent of keeping the Road Pony out of direct conflict with combat vehicles. This variant replaced the light rifle with either an SRM-6 and retaining the infantry bay or two LRM-5s and completely removing the infantry bay. These models tended to be distributed with 3 SRM variants and 1 LRM variant per mechanized infantry platoon. Still vulnerable to enemy fire, fewer were lost because they were used with greater standoff and in a more defensive role.

Overview:
The Road Donkey is RDS' attempt to apply a stranglehold on the arms supply systems throughout the Inner Sphere during the 25th Century. Introduced at the conclusion of the 24th Century in 2397, the Road Donkey was optimized for providing logistical support to RDS authorized designs. Every RDS design that post-dated the Road Donkey is designed to integrate seemlessly with a logistics system that utilizes the Road Donkey as the primarly logistics transport. To ensure defense planners and spenders were locked into the RDS system longterm, RDS sales personnel would bundle Road Donkeys with other military vehicles, offer the Road Donkey at steep discounts, and offer low-cost, extended-maintenance contracts on the Road Pony to ensure that it saturated the market.
This strategy was effective at locking purchasing agents into long term relationships with RDS throught the 2450s, but competitors eventually began building their new models of combat systems to match the Road Donkey's capabilities. Even today, many standardized logistics packages are based on the capabilities of the Road Donkey as many early Battlemechs adopted quick-load weapon systems that fit the bed of a Road Donkey and several weapons systems ordnance is restricted in size to meet with the cargo requirements of the Road Donkey.

Capabilities:
The Road Donkey was introduced six years after the Road Pony and utilized many of the same components including tires, major suspension components, lights, and electrical components as the Road Pony. RDS intended the Road Donkey to compete with and supplant the earlier Katir built by AAIL, but the proven effectiveness of the Katir and its dramatically lower price prevented RDS from pushing AAIL out of the Medium Truck completely. However, this initial strategy set the requirements for the Road Donkey. RDS built the Road Donkey so that it could carry heavier and larger payloads, and it could traverse even more difficult terrain than the Katir. As part of the tow-kit for the Road Donkey, the Road Donkey mounted a winch rated to 13 tons. This winch assisted in loading and unloading cargo, but also allowed the Road Donkey to practice self-recovery when operating in the most difficult terrain.

Deployment:
RDS produced more than 35 million Road Donkeys before the company ceased production in the 27th century. After production ended, more than 10 different production companies, including several state-run producers, built more than 200 million medium trucks with specifications identical to the Road Donkey through the beginning of the Clan War. The design continues to be produced today, but because the Road Donkey has often served in direct support of front-line military units (mostly because it is so capable a member of a front-line logistics network), many have been destroyed throughout the course of the Succession Wars. Today, estimates of the numbers of Road Donkey's on active service range from 1.2 million to 1.8 million. In any given year, the entire production capabilities of the various factories capable of Road Donkey production have the capacity to build nearly a half million Road Donkeys per year but demand rarely exceeds 100,000.


Variants:
Like the preceding Katir, the Road Donkey has a multitude of variants that allow it to succeed in its logistics role. The first variant adds a lift-hoist to the vehicle for loading and unloading cargo. This variant is also primarily used to recover other light and medium vehicles.
Another variant commonly seen in support of combat units is a variant that installs a field kitchen. This unit also has a 1-ton refrigerated cargo section that can hold 3/4 of a ton of perishable items. An additional 1/2 ton storage area is used to carry non-perishable items and potable water. This model also occassionally installs a single core MASH unit and a second operating theater.
A final variant installs a combat control center with .5 tons of advanced controls and mounts either an LRM-5 or SRM-4 in a rear sponson. This model also mounts a full ton (22 points) of BAR 7 armor.

Overview:
Intended to replace the Road Pony Armored Personnel Carrier, the Swamp Pony is almost twice the weight of the older vehicle. Despite this, the Swamp Pony is only 10% longer and taller and 20% wider than the Road Pony. Introduced in 2417, RDS offered massive discounts to military organizations that previously relied on the Road Pony for infantry transport.
While most of these users could clearly see the Swamp Pony as an upgrade over their Road Ponies, most could not justify the added cost of the vehicle simply for the advantage of having an amphibious vehicle. Additionally, since the armor coverage was roughly equivalent to the Road Pony's, many potential customers declined to purchase the vehicle considering the medium rifle to be a drawback that would encourage the misuse of the vehicle. The marketing campaign resulted in thousands of purchases of Swamp Ponies on worlds with large bodies of water, but sales flatlined and then declined after this market was saturated.
To generate new sales and recover the product line, Richard Bees, an RDS executive, revamped the design in 2432. The new design dropped the amphibious capabilities for an armored chassis, heavier armor, and a super-charger. By 2435 two out of every three Swamp Pony sales were the new design and by 2440 only one in five Swamp Ponies had amphibious capability.

Capabilities:
With the exception of its amphibious capability and medium rifle, the Swamp Pony has roughly the same capabilities as the Road Pony. Its longer range medium rifle gives the design more stand-off, but it also encourages crews to engage targets with greater capacity to destroy their own vehicle.
The Swamp Pony's amphibious chassis enables it to not only traverse the swampy terrain for which it is named, but it allows it to travel across open seas. Unfortunately, though, the water jet systems that provide motive force for the Swamp Pony are inefficient and the vehicle suffers from the Gas Hog design trait when traveling in water depth 1 or greater. The armored variant that eventually superseded the original design was capable of engaging heavier foes, but was almost impossible for IFF systems to differentiate from the original.


Deployment:
In the first fifteen years of the design's life, RDS sold just about 5,000 Swamp Ponies. In total, RDS would sell about 18,000 Swamp Ponies before the design was completely retired, with most of the Swamp Ponies sold prior to the introduction of CSC's Cychreides. The armored Swamp Pony, though, proved to be extremely popular and is the reason the Swamp Pony is available through several small manufacturers today. RDS produced and sold almost 30,000 of the armored Swamp Pony variant before transferring the production lines to several local manufacturers in the Federated Suns and Free Worlds League. By the time of the Succession Wars the seven manufacturing plants, all of which could produce a Swamp Pony from start to finish with raw inputs, were in the hands of local nobles. These plants were also capable of producing Road Ponies and Road Donkeys as well.
As of 3025, an Draconis Combine assessment of Federated Suns military capacity estimated the number of active Swamp Ponies in the Federated Suns at 22,500.


Variants:
The most common variant that eventually overshadowed the original was the armored variant dubbed the "Road Pony II" by many users. This variant included an armored chassis and removed the amphibious capabilities. Using the same DL Cummins 9024 as the original, it featured a supercharger for higher speeds, and it also included 2.5 tons of BAR 8 armor. The Succession Wars variant produced by the new owners of the former RDS factories mounted a medium laser and a machinegun with half a ton of ammunition. The infantry bays were expanded to allow for the transport of two squads, and a power amp replaced the supercharger.
